有人可以帮我使这段代码更好吗

时间:2018-10-03 20:51:15

标签: python python-3.x

food = ['pizza' , 'bread' , 'apple' , 'banana' , 'hamburger']

print(food[0].upper())

我想在一行中打印所有索引,并且所有索引都间隔开并且彼此不连接。我还想弄清楚如何小写所有索引以及将其保留为标题。

这就是我想要的样子:

PIZZA BREAD APPLE BANANA HAMBURGER

pizza bread apple banana hamburger

Pizza Bread Apple Banana Hamburger

1 个答案:

答案 0 :(得分:1)

join可用于压缩任何可迭代的元素,例如字符串,列表或元组,' '将以此作为分隔符的元素进行连接,并将最终输出作为字符串返回

' '.join(food).upper() 
' '.join(food).lower()
' '.join(food).title()